One Final Home Stand at St. Andrew's @ Knighthead Park
The final home fixture of the season is fast approaching, and Blues Women are ready for the ultimate showdown as they take on Ipswich Town on Sunday 26 April, kick-off 2pm, at St Andrew’s @ Knighthead Park.
Supporters can purchase tickets here, with prices starting from just £3.
Pressure is a privilege. It is the reward for a season of persistent ambition, a strengthened squad, and a proven drive that has placed Amy Merricks’ side exactly where they want to be, top of the table. With 41 points on the board and the Barclays Women's Super League within touching distance, the end goal is clear. But as the finish line nears, the stakes couldn't be higher. On Sunday 26 April, Blues Women return to St. Andrew’s @ Knighthead Park for the final home fixture of the season against Ipswich Town.
Earlier this season, Birmingham City Women displayed a dominant 4-0 victory over the Tractor Girls. But at this stage of the seasons campaign, records belong to the past, and this final home fixture is about the future. It is about a club that has used the heartbreak of last season’s final-day narrow miss as fundamental fuel. This year, the hunger is different. This year, the drive is unstoppable.
The recent Adobe Women’s FA Cup quarterfinal against Manchester City served as a definitive proof of perception. While the result was a narrow defeat, the performance against the top of the Women’s Super League spoke volumes. It showcased a team that doesn't just compete with the best, it belongs among them. The FA Cup quarterfinal fixture delivered the highest attendance so far this season, but for the final home push, Blues Women need more. The noise from inside St. Andrew’s @ Knighthead Park needs to be heard across the city, not just from within the stadium bowl.
Emerging from that cup run and an intense international break with 11 players on representative duty, the squad returns to B9 stronger and more unified than ever. Amy Merricks has built a group capable of greatness, but for the final 90 minutes on home turf, the tactics on the pitch need the roar from the stands.
Bluenoses are the 12th player, the noise, the energy, and the passion of the Blue Army are the differences that the opposition cannot account for.
This final home fixture is more than just a 90-minute game of football. It is the result of a journey. It is a chance to witness a team on the verge of success and to ensure that when we rise, we do it together.
The heartbreak of last season is in the past and the WSL is in sights. Let’s make St. Andrew’s @ Knighthead Park a fortress one last time this season.
